Merger or Consolidation of, or Assumption of the Obligations of, Master Servicer. Any Person (a) into which the Master Servicer may be merged or consolidated, (b) which may result from any merger or consolidation to which the Master Servicer shall be a party or (c) which may succeed to the properties and assets of the Master Servicer, substantially as a whole, shall be the successor to the Master Servicer without the execution or filing of any document or any further act by any of the parties to this Agreement; provided, however, that the Master Servicer hereby covenants that it will not consummate any of the foregoing transactions except upon satisfaction of the following: (i) the surviving Master Servicer (if other than _____________) executes an agreement of assumption to perform every obligation of the Master Servicer under this Agreement, (ii) immediately after giving effect to such transaction, no representation or warranty made pursuant to Section 6.1 shall have been breached and no Servicer Default, and no event that, after notice or lapse of time, or both, would become a Servicer Default shall have occurred and be continuing, (iii) the Master Servicer shall have delivered to the Owner Trustee and the Trustee an Officers' Certificate and an Opinion of Counsel each stating that such consolidation, merger or succession and such agreement of assumption comply with this Section and that all conditions precedent, if any, provided for in this Agreement relating to such transaction have been complied with, and that the Rating Agency Condition shall have been satisfied with respect to such transaction, (iv) the surviving Master Servicer shall have a consolidated net worth at least equal to that of the predecessor Master Servicer, and (v) such transaction will not result in a material adverse federal or state tax consequence to the Issuer, the Noteholders or the Certificateholders.
